A 22-YEAR-OLD Stourbridge man has pleaded not guilty to murdering a pensioner at a Shropshire beauty spot.
Moses Christensen has denied murdering 70-year-old Staffordshire pensioner Richard Hall, whose body was found on August 14 near the summit of Brown Clee Hill, Shropshire.
Christensen, of Corser Street, Oldswinford, entered the not guilty plea this morning (Wednesday January 13) when he appeared before Stafford Crown Court via video link.
Currently in custody, he must now await a murder trial which has been scheduled for February 23.
